Being menopausal brought on a lot of changes in my body that I wasn’t prepared for, especially around my sexual health and wellbeing. I decided to book a consultation at Skin Reform in Sandton, and from the moment I walked in, I felt reassured. Something can be done to help me, and it does not require any surgery.
The procedure itself was surprisingly simple. After a thorough discussion with Sr. Theri, a numbing cream was applied, which made the treatment far more comfortable than I anticipated. The laser is designed to stimulate collagen and elastin production, gently tightening the skin and improving hydration. I felt only a slight warmth and tingling sensation. The entire process took less than an hour. There was no downtime, other than following the aftercare instructions for a few days.
In the weeks that followed, I started noticing subtle but meaningful changes. My labia felt smoother and firmer, and the dryness I had been struggling with began to ease. Intimacy became more comfortable again, and I realised just how much I had been missing that part of myself.
